Summary:
The world market's increasing demands for lightweight constructions as a means of reducing fuel consumption in transportation systems, together with shrinking materials resources, are becoming factors of major importance. These aspects are further underlined by current efforts aimed at reducing the greenhouse-gas emissions caused by production processes. In this context, considerate use of energy-intensive materials, such as aluminum, plays a major role.
